POSITION DETAILS
The Finance Procurement Specialist will report to the Director of Business and Fiscal Affairs at The City College of New York. In addition to the CUNY Title Overview, the Finance Procurement Specialist duties include but are not limited to the following:
- Work effectively individually and collaboratively with internal and external College
stakeholders; the College???s academic and operations departments; other units with the
Office of Finance like Budget, Financial Accounting and Accounts Payable; the University
General Counsel???s Office, and the Central Office of Facility Planning, Construction and
Management.
- Prepare ad-hoc reports, queries, and analyses on purchasing data.
- Administers all matters assigned and related to both tax levy and non-tax levy purchases,
including developing bid specifications, advertising in the NYS Contract Reporter, negotiating
contracts with vendors based on price and product specifications through a variety of
procurement methods ??? Invitation for Bids, Request for Proposals, Expressions of Interest,
etc.
- Ability to draft solicitations documents and procurement record memoranda.
- Ensure that all purchase requisitions are processed and sourced in a timely manner.
- Assist in the implementation of comprehensive internal controls for any new or revised
purchasing procedures.
- Provide training for faculty, staff, and end users in CUNYfirst and the NYS Financial System.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
